HCAC Announces 2025 Football All-Conference Awards

CARMEL, Ind. – The Heartland Collegiate Athletic Conference (HCAC) announced the 2025 Football All-Conference and special awards winners on Wednesday.

Hanover standout quarterback Eian Roudebush (New Palestine, Ind.) earned the title of 2025 HCAC Offensive Player of the Year. Aston leads the HCAC in quarterback efficiency with a 198.3 rating and completion percentage, with 77.2%, during conference play. As a leader offensively on the Panthers squad, his offense averaged 41 points per game which helped the Panthers obtain the HCAC's automatic bid to the NCAA tournament. 

Joining his teammate from the other side of the field, Brian Wall (Sellersburg, Ind.) was named the 2025 HCAC Defensive Player of the Year. The sophomore led his squad in tackles and finds himself in the top 10 in the HCAC for interceptions with 2 during conference play. His leadership on a dominant Panthers defense, helped Hanover clinch the 2024 HCAC Regular Season title.
 
Earning this year's HCAC Special Teams Player of the Year award is Clint Hearne (Madison, Ind.) from Hanover College.  During the 2025 season, the senior kicker was 46/49 in PAT attempts and 5/7 in field goal attempts, which all helped contribute to the Panther's success. Hearne earned 3 HCAC Athlete of the Week honors this season and registered his longest kick of the season at 52 yards.
 
The HCAC recognizes an athlete in their first year of athletic competition who stands out above the rest as the Newcomer of the Year. The league's coaches selected Bluffton first year Jaivon Hudson (Bedford, Ohio) as the 2025 HCAC Newcomer of the Year. The running back shared the backfield as a true freshman for the Beavers and still found himself sitting at 2nd in the HCAC for total rushing yards in conference play with 477 yards.

Helping lead the Panthers offensively for the 2025 season, the Coordinator of the Year award was awarded to Hanover Offensive Coordinator, Chase Burton. Coach Burton shares the sideline with Hanover head coach Matthew Theobald, who was voted as the 2025 HCAC Coach of the Year. Coach Burton and Coach Theobald lead the Panthers to a perfect 6-0 record in HCAC play, claiming the 2025 HCAC Football Regular Season title and a berth in the 2025 NCAA Division III Football Playoffs which is the Panthers first NCAA appearance since 2019.
